Until Rohl came in there's never been a true synergy between academy and first team. It's why I banged on about downgrading and creating a B team There wasn't even true cohesion between u15/16s and the first-year scholarship group which is why we always used to hold open trials at U18s. The 18s, 23s (as then was) and the first team all played different styles depending on who was in the squads which became a major reason why we used to release so many. Rohl has everyone from u15 upwards playing the same way and has instigated a coach the coaches programme coupled with the likes of Vaulks doing his coaching hours in there as well. It's stuff like this that makes me feel Rohl is here for the duration.
